On average across the year,
Belgium is approximately as hot as
Ann Arbor, Michigan
.
Belgium has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F and Ann Arbor, Michigan has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.
Belgium's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 23°C/73°F, which is not hotter than Ann Arbor, Michigan's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F).
On average across the year, Belgium is approximately as cold as Ann Arbor, Michigan . Belgium has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F and Ann Arbor, Michigan has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F.
On average across the year,
no, Belgium has less rain than
Ann Arbor, Michigan. Belgium has an average annual rainfall of 506mm and Ann Arbor, Michigan has an average annual rainfall of 866mm.
Belgium's wettest month is June, with an average monthly rainfall of 56mm, which is drier than Ann Arbor, Michigan's wettest month (September, with an average monthly rainfall of 98mm).
